Interview
Even before Mustique Gourmet took shape in Tavira, João Pedro Meira and his parents shared a clear idea: to create a place where Portugal could be appreciated with time, intention and beauty.
A natural communicator with a background in the world of luxury, João Pedro returned to the south determined to turn memory into narrative and a sense of place into curation.
In this conversation, he speaks about returning home, family, the rhythm of Tavira and the vision that gives Mustique Gourmet its soul and direction.


João Pedro Meira
“I want people to feel that they have stepped into a place where time slows down and everything has been chosen with intention. Above all, I want them to come with a spirit of discovery.”
Why the name Mustique Gourmet?
The name Mustique Gourmet comes from this idea of a haven. In the 1970s, for many people living in London — artists, creatives and those who needed room to breathe — the island of Mustique was a paradise, an escape from the city’s relentless pace. A place of light, rest and truth. When I think about our family, I see a natural parallel: we too left London in search of time, simplicity and purpose. We headed south, towards the light of the Algarve, to create a place where life slows down and the best of Portugal can be celebrated at an unhurried pace. Mustique Gourmet is exactly that — not the island itself, but the feeling of finding a place where one can finally live authentically.
What made you want to create this project with your parents?
Above all, Mustique Gourmet is a family project. My parents have always been my anchor, and this space is the natural continuation of our story. Each of us brings something essential: my mother’s aesthetic sensitivity, my father’s sense of place and personal connection, and my editorial vision. Together, we have created somewhere that is not merely commercial: it is emotional, rooted in identity and unmistakably ours.
What does “curation” mean to you at Mustique Gourmet?
For me, curation is everything that happens before a product reaches the shelf. We do not work with wholesalers; we work brand by brand — more than 50, each chosen individually. There is an intense, almost obsessive process of research behind finding the very best: discreet producers, forgotten projects and brands that deserve both a stage and a story worthy of them. Mustique Gourmet is not a catalogue; it is a filter. Everything that comes through our doors must answer one simple question: does this represent the Portugal we want to celebrate?

And the future?
The future of Mustique Gourmet lies in growing slowly, coherently and with complete loyalty to our sense of place. We want to deepen our curation, create experiences, give producers a stage and remain a haven for those who live here and those who visit us. Mustique Gourmet is not a destination; it is a path we are building as a family.
What do you hope people will feel when they enter Mustique Gourmet?
I want people to feel that they have stepped into a place where time slows down and everything has been chosen with intention. Above all, I want them to come with a spirit of discovery — to find exceptional products they have never seen before, discreet projects that deserve a stage and flavours that surprise them. At the same time, I hope there is a sense of rediscovery: historic brands that belong to our collective memory, such as Couto toothpaste, reconnecting us with a familiar and affectionate Portugal. Mustique Gourmet lives in this balance between the new and the nostalgic, between discovery and remembrance.
